Suggested Answer:
Box 1: Yes -
ג€Allow interaction with custom appsג€ in the org-wide policy and ג€upload custom appsג€ in the global policy are set to on. This means that users can upload custom apps to teams that allow it and to teams for which they are owners.

Box 2: Yes -
The global policy allows Microsoft Flow.

Box 3: No -
The global policy allows Microsoft Planner. However, the org-wide settings blocks Microsoft Planner. In this case, the org-wide policy blocking the app will override the global policy meaning the app will be blocked. When an app is blocked, users will not be able to add the app to a team.
